The Bachelor of Information Sciences (BISc.) provides students with the knowledge and skills on how to establish programs to collect and analyze data, which will better equip people to function within their work environments. This program draws upon business administration, mathematics, computer science and economics, focusing on the methods and techniques for effective collection and analysis of data. UNB offers several areas of specialization: Decision & Business Management; and Decision & Systems Science.

Admission Requirements

  • English 122/Francais 10411 (min. grade of 60%)
  • Pre-Calculus A 120/Mathematique 30331C* (min. grade of 65%)
  • Pre-Calculus B 120/Mathematique 30411C (min. grade of 65%)
  • Two Electives - Group 1 (min. grade of 60%)
  • One Elective - Group 1 or 2 (min. grade of 60%)
  • Minimum admission average 75%
  • *Mathematique 30411B is acceptable for admission. However UNB strongly recommends Mathematique 30331C as the preferred pre-requisite to Mathematique 30411C.
  • **Biologie 53421 and Physique 51421 are acceptable for admission.
